The course also teaches strength training, choreography and lessons that can be applied to pretty much any dance genre. “What’s unique about this class is … The governing aesthetic principle of the Rockettes is uniformity. Though they range in height from five-foot four inches to five-foot nine (having gotten progressively taller over the years), the illusion that they are all the same height is achieved by placing the tallest dancers in the center of the line and sloping downward. Dec 9, 2019 · Here are some fun facts about the Rockettes…. 1957 is the first year they participated in the Macy’s Thanksgiving Day Parade. 1933 was the first Christmas Spectacular show. Jennifer Jones became the first African American Rockette in 1987. They used to perform before movies that were being shown at the theater. While it might look like their heights are uniform, they all fall within that range. To make it look like they're all the same height, the taller dancers are in the center and the shorter dancers taper out toward the end. There are 80 Rockettes total.
